Serious Games: Transforming Learning and Skill Development

March 17, 2025

Serious games combine interactive experiences with structured objectives to enhance learning and skill development. Unlike traditional games, they focus on education, training, and problem-solving across various industries. Organizations use them to improve workforce readiness, enhance medical training, and teach complex subjects through simulation.

Serious game development requires a strategic approach to ensure effectiveness. Clear objectives, engaging mechanics, and measurable outcomes define a successful project. Developers incorporate real-world scenarios, adaptive difficulty, and data-driven feedback to maintain engagement while ensuring skill acquisition. The right balance between entertainment and education keeps players motivated, making learning more efficient.

Businesses, healthcare institutions, and educational organizations integrate serious games into their training programs to improve knowledge retention and practical application. Virtual reality, augmented reality, and AI-driven features further enhance interactivity and personalization.

Adoption of serious game development continues to grow as industries recognize its benefits. Whether improving employee performance, teaching critical skills, or simulating real-life scenarios, these games offer practical solutions that traditional training methods often fail to deliver.

Key Elements That Set a Serious Game Apart

Successful serious games rely on structured mechanics that engage users while reinforcing practical knowledge. Unlike standard training modules, they incorporate interactive features tailored to real-world applications.

Key components of a serious game include:

  • Defined learning objectives. Each game targets specific skills or knowledge areas, guiding users through structured challenges.
  • Adaptive difficulty levels. Adjusting complexity based on performance keeps learners engaged and prevents frustration.
  • Data-driven feedback. Real-time insights help users track progress and identify areas needing improvement.
  • Scenario-based learning. Simulated environments mimic real-world conditions, enabling hands-on practice in a controlled setting.
  • Engagement mechanics. Storytelling, rewards, and competition elements sustain motivation throughout the learning process.

Gamification companies implement these elements to develop training simulations, healthcare interventions, and corporate learning solutions. Realistic VFX elements further enhance engagement, making serious games effective tools for knowledge retention and skill acquisition.

Training Simulations

Practical experience remains critical in fields requiring precision, quick decision-making, and procedural knowledge. Training simulations provide risk-free environments where users can practice tasks before applying them in real-world situations. Industries such as aviation, healthcare, and manufacturing rely on these tools to build proficiency in complex operations.

Pilots refine their flight skills, medical professionals perform virtual surgeries, and industrial workers familiarize themselves with hazardous environments. Simulations replicate realistic scenarios, reinforcing skills through repetition and adaptive feedback.

AI-driven models adjust difficulty based on user performance, ensuring training remains challenging yet manageable. Real-time analytics help instructors assess progress, identifying areas needing improvement. The combination of interactive learning and real-world application bridges the gap between theory and practice, making training simulations one of the most effective skill development forms.

Balancing Challenge and Motivation to Keep Players Engaged

Maintaining engagement requires the right balance between challenge and motivation. Games that are too difficult frustrate players, while those that are too easy lead to disengagement. The table below compares key aspects of challenge and motivation in serious game design.

AspectChallengeMotivation
PurposeEnsures tasks require effort and skill development.Keeps players interested and invested in progression.
Difficulty AdjustmentDynamic scaling based on player performance.Rewards and progression systems maintain engagement.
FeedbackReal-time responses highlight mistakes and suggest improvements.Positive reinforcement through achievements and in-game recognition.
User AutonomyDecision-making opportunities that impact outcomes.Meaningful choices create a sense of ownership.
ProgressionGradual introduction of complexity.Unlocking new levels, content, or rewards sustains motivation.
Engagement MechanicsTimed challenges, puzzles, or problem-solving tasks.Storytelling, competition, or cooperative gameplay.

Serious games that integrate both structured challenges and motivational incentives provide the most effective learning experiences.

Measuring Effectiveness and Tracking Real-World Skill Acquisition

Success in serious games isn’t just about engagement — it’s about measurable learning outcomes. Tracking progress, assessing skill development, and analyzing behavioral changes determine whether a game meets its educational objectives.

Methods for evaluating effectiveness:

  • Performance analytics. In-game data tracks accuracy, speed, and decision-making improvements.
  • Pre- and post-assessments. Comparing initial and final results highlights knowledge gains.
  • User feedback. Surveys and interviews reveal insights into player experiences and learning impact.
  • Simulation-to-application transfer. Observing real-world task execution determines knowledge retention.
  • Engagement metrics. Completion rates, session duration, and repeated play sessions indicate effectiveness.

Strong measurement systems distinguish well-designed serious games from passive learning tools. Meaningful data analysis helps refine mechanics, optimize learning paths, and align training experiences with real-world applications.

Expanding Beyond Screens with VR and AR Technologies

Virtual and augmented reality enhance serious games by creating immersive environments beyond traditional screen-based interactions. VR transports users into fully interactive simulations where they engage with objects, navigate spaces, and practice skills in realistic settings. AR overlays digital elements onto the physical world, blending real-world scenarios with interactive training components.

Combining these technologies allows for hands-on practice without real-world risks, making them particularly valuable in fields like medical training, defense simulations, and industrial safety. Real-time interaction with digital assets strengthens engagement, helping users develop muscle memory and situational awareness. The continuous advancement of XR hardware and software expands the potential applications of serious games, increasing their effectiveness as tools for skill development and experiential learning.
